Flophouze Shipping Container Hotel - Houze 2

Built from recycled shipping containers, these simply amazing, durable, iron boxes were once used to ship just about anything imaginable around the globe by land and sea.

Now, with a new lease on life, FLOPHOUZE has transformed these containers into unique, comfortable, cozy living spaces. Come. Stay. You won't want to leave.

This unit will sleep 4 comfortably. There are two twin size beds at one end and a full-sized pull-out couch at the other end of the 300 sq. foot space. An efficient Hollywood bathroom separates the space.

Outside, each Houze has its own hammock, fire pit, and chairs. Inside, the kitchenette features a sink, microwave, mini-fridge, tea kettle and Chemex coffee maker for the morning get up and goers! The interiors are cladded with sustainably harvested wood from our farm in upstate New York and reclaimed lumber from a distillery in Kentucky. The windows were salvaged from a school in Philadelphia that was slated for demolition and provide tons of natural light. On a playful note, we installed kitchen cabinet bases from an FDA laboratory in Brooklyn, and old bowling alley floors from Texas to complete the countertops!

Upon your arrival, each casa will have complimentary coffee and tea, Topochico sparkling water, and Mexican Cokes. Just a short drive away in Round Top, there is a market for light snacks and other goodies. Every detail has been carefully crafted to ensure that your stay is a memorable one.
